onCreate,onCreateOptionsMenu,onResume,执行的顺序是什么?

时间:2013-09-23 09:01:21

标签: android android-activity oncreate onresume oncreateoptionsmenu

对不起,如果之前有人问这个问题...... 那么无论如何标题要求,onCreateOptionsMenu何时执行?在onResume之前或之后?

在我的应用中, 当活动首次运行/打开时,订单将是onCreate - > onResume - > onCreateOptionsMenu

但是如果我改变设备的方向,它会自动调用onDestroy,因此将重新创建活动,在这种情况下,订单将是onCreate - > onCreateOptionsMenu - >的onResume

我现在很困惑......任何人都可以对此作出解释吗?

1 个答案:

答案 0 :(得分:6)

您可以阅读onCreateOptionsMenu this

  

仅在第一次显示选项菜单时调用此选项。要在每次显示菜单时更新菜单,请参阅onPrepareOptionsMenu(菜单)。